Just wanted to some clarification in terms of bulb models.
I have a '97 GPvR facelift model.
Just confirmed that it has standard HID for main low beam lights.
However, the parking lights are yellow, I wanted to change it to white so that it matches the main lights.

A few questions:
1. What is the model for that parking light? Is it a standard T10 wedge bulb?
2. While at it, I might as well change the interior night light and rear number plates light, is that also a T10 wedge bulb?
3. I see that the high beam for GPvR model is not HID but yellow, to replace this to white, do I use the HB3 (9005)? Has anyone done this?
4. For those who has changed their interior light, which colour looks good, white or blue???

1. Parker T10
2. rear no. plates T10 ; map/reading light - 38mm bayonet
3. HB3 HID 5000k color temp = white
4. blue = rice , white = elegant
